The persisting bacterial presence, together with a lack of
thoroughly hermetic seal between the prepared tooth walls and the
final finished fixed prosthesis walls allow bacterial leakage and
thus may be involved in the development of recurrent caries.several
species of bacteria may be isolated from plaque associated with
carious lesions and pulpal inflammation. Streptococcus mutants is
one of the bacteria most frequently implicated in dental
caries.Antibacterial activity, during and after setting, assumes
clinical relevance because this property may help in the
elimination or reduction of bacteria that have remained viable in
the cavity wallsor bacteria that may gain access to the cavity
through micro leakage channels. This book provides access and
compares the incessant antibacterial activity of Glass Ionomer
Cement(Ketac-Cem), Zinc Phosphate Cement(Harvard) and
Polycarboxylate(Poly-F) in 2 powder: liquid ratios(wt/wt) by
undertaking Direct-Contact Test and Agar Diffusion Test
